The commission unanimously approved demolition of the fire-damaged Lincoln Avenue School, citing extensive destruction and safety risks. It also approved multiple historic-district projects, including garages, porch work, repairs, and new construction.

Lincoln Avenue School was approved for demolition after a fire caused the roof to collapse and severely damaged the interior. Milwaukee Public Schools said it would salvage architectural brick or stone if doing so is safe and allowed by contamination testing. The commission also amended its bylaws so it will not review rear-yard planting beds on mid-block lots when they cannot be seen from the public street.
